Keyless Entry

Keyless entry (or RKE) is the possibility of opening and locking your car without using keys that are physically present. It works with a system of radio signals that your car emits, and a key fob that looks for them. Once the fob is within the range of those signals it transmits its own unique code back to the vehicle, which then unlocks or blocks the doors. This technology is utilized in most modern cars such as sportscars, SUVs and electric models such as the Toyota GR Supra.

Keyless Start

A number of manufacturers offer the option of a keyless starting system which makes it easy to get in and out of your vehicle. This feature, also referred to as KEYLESS GO, is very similar to push to start (but there are some differences). You must have your key fob close to the vehicle to use the feature. When you are near the vehicle your key fob transmits a signal to the car. If the car detects this signal and confirms it is your key fob, then the car will open your doors or trunk.

Then, you can enter the vehicle and press the button to start the engine. When the engine is running, pushing the start/stop button once more will turn on your electrical items such as the radio. A third push will turn everything off.

This technology is popular and is used in a wide range of vehicles in the present, including budget models. It's not essential for cars, but it's a nice extra. It's especially beneficial for people with arthritis or other conditions which make it difficult to grasp the mechanical keys. Some locks lock your car after you leave. If you forget to close and lock the car thieves could 'grab your key fob', open the door and leave with your car.

A keyless remote transmits a signal that is received by sensors in your mini new key. The receiver module interprets the signal and then responds. If the sensor detects signals it cannot interpret, it won't take action based on it and your car will not respond to any commands coming from the key fob.

cropped-KeyLab-1.pngThe transmitter and receiver modules of the key fob make use of a rolling code technology which means that the signal sent every time is distinct. This can prevent unauthorized transmissions from being recorded and then retransmitted later on to gain access to a secure area.

Keyless entry systems that relies on rolling codes could be compromised by a technique called replay attach. A rogue device placed close to the receiver within the building or vehicle that is secured records every signal sent and retransmits them at a later time.

Key Replacement

Because keys for MINI Cooper and BMW cars are highly specialised, they are not as easy to make as regular keys for cars. Replacing or fixing a key for these types of vehicles is a special service that involves taking the CAS module of your car out, connecting it to a soldering station and extracting the key data to make a new replacement key.
